About The Position

Tufts Medicine Primary Care is seeking a Primary Care Regional Medical Director to oversee our primary care practices in our Lowell area market. We are seeking tenured primary care physicians with the acumen to lead our practices to continued success and to support the goals of Tufts Medicine Primary Care across five domains: quality, patient experience, access, growth and financial stewardship.

  • Manage day to day operations, clinical practice oversight, and staff engagement
  • Focus on patient care and develop longitudinal relationships with your patients
  • Own driving quality-based goals for your team through evidence-based practices, performance measurement, and continuous quality improvement initiatives.
  • Provide service and people focused support to meet the needs of patients, providers management and staff
  • Manage practice relationships with regional Specialists to keep care local and ensure that care referred to Specialists is high quality and effective
  • Work cross-functionally with executive level leadership to provide direction in the implementation of business and medical strategies, organizational initiatives, and priorities
  • Partner with the clinically integrated network to drive success in value-based contracting, including improving population health metrics, reducing the total cost of care, and achieving performance-based targets tied to risk-based agreements, all while fostering a culture of accountability, collaboration and continuous learning.
  • Optimize access to care through innovative care models (e.g., team-based case, telehealth), efficient scheduling and panel management strategies.
  • Effectively manage, facilitate, and communicate organizational change
  • Ensure clinical functions foster the organization’s desired culture of service excellence, accountability and achieves established business goals
  • Partner with the Provider Recruitment and Retention team and leadership to design and implement retention programs to ensure the availability of a qualified workforce including temporary provider staffing
